Crime overview

Church Road area has the 6th lowest crime rate of 39 local areas in North Hanwell , and the 143rd lowest crime rate of 964 local areas in Ealing .

This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Church Road (W7 3BE) in the last 12 months was 34.4 per 1,000 residents and was 50.7% lower than the North Hanwell average (69.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 6 offences recorded. The least common crime was Drugs with 1 case , down -50.0% compared to 2024. All major crime categories fell. The sharpest drop was Vehicle crime ( -75.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 9 (β‰ˆ 22.1 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-55.0% ).

In the area around Church Road (W7 3BE), the main crime hotspot is near Tennyson Road. Police recorded 50 crimes here, including 17 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
